In this vlog, we explore the socio-emotional, moral, and spiritual development that takes place during late adulthood. Drawing from Erik Erikson’s theory of psychosocial development, particularly the "integrity vs. despair" stage, we discuss how older adults reflect on life and achieve emotional resilience (Erikson, 1950). Additionally, we refer to Kohlberg’s stages of moral development, which explain the progression of moral reasoning in later years (Kohlberg, 1981).
We also delve into the role of spirituality, which often deepens with age. Research suggests that many older adults turn to spirituality to find meaning and peace in their lives (Preston, n.d.). Furthermore, religion plays a significant role in promoting well-being and offering a sense of purpose during later years (Kaplan, 2023).
